Understanding The Frightening Wait: 5 Signs Your Contact Lens Is Still Inside Your Eye

But what exactly happens when a contact lens becomes dislodged and gets stuck in the eye? The mechanics of The Frightening Wait: 5 Signs Your Contact Lens Is Still Inside Your Eye can be complex and often involve a combination of factors.

When a contact lens is inserted into the eye, it floats on a layer of tears, allowing it to move freely. However, if the lens becomes dislodged, it can become trapped under the eyelid or between the cornea and the eyelid's surface. This can lead to immense discomfort, blurred vision, and even eye infections.
